About Ebenezer Walker

Walter G. Ashworth • Ebenezer Walker is my 6th great grandfather.



Ebenezer Walker, son of Philip & Jane (Metcalf) Walker b. Nov 1676, d. 13 March 1717-18 at Rehoboth MA; He m1) 19 Nov 1700 Mehitable Wilmarth. She d. 27 Oct 1702. He m2) 11 Oct 1703 to Dorothy Abell. She b. 18 Nov 1677 at Rehoboth MA, dau of Lieut. Preserved & Martha (Redaway) Abell. She d. 1 Aug 1741 Rehoboth MA. She married 2d, 13 June 1724 at Rehoboth MA to John Reed. He and his wife renewed the covenant in 1709. They had 11 children. Resided Rehoboth, now Seekonk.
